Mercedes Moné Shares Plans To Create Her Own Wrestling Company

Mercedes Moné isn’t just playing the role of CEO on AEW TV, but the TBS Champion plans on making it a reality. Speaking with Katee Sackhoff, Moné shared her desire to build her legacy in wrestling outside of the ring.

“I definitely want to help own a wrestling company one day and be the woman of change and voice of change over there for any wrestling company that wants to have me.”

Moné, who joined AEW less than a year ago, added that she has always wanted to serve as a shareholder and “be a part of helping and creating” in wrestling.

Should Moné found her own promotion, she’d join a long list of talents to make the move from competitor to promotor. In 2002, Jeff Jarrett co-founded TNA Wrestling, aware that WWE would not want to rehire him after his controversial exit in 1999. Years later, Cody Rhodes and the Elite would found AEW, the promotion Mone works for to this day.

It remains to be seen if Moné creates her own company, but in the meantime, she continues to excel in the ring as the AEW TBS Champion and NJPW Strong Women’s Champion. Next month will mark one year since her AEW debut. With her one-year anniversary looming, Mone certainly has big plans, both in and out of the ring.
